Managing IT infrastructure can be a daunting task for any business, but it can be even more challenging for smaller organizations with limited resources. Over time, these businesses often end up with ad hoc IT processes and small teams trying to support increasingly complex IT needs—in some cases, with team members juggling multiple roles. These challenges can distract from core activities, frustrate users, hinder productivity and even introduce security concerns.

The freedom to focus on what matters

One way to focus more on business operations and less on IT is to leverage managed device service solutions. These solutions offer businesses with a range of options, including deploying devices, ensuring applications are up to date so employees can be productive, keeping them secure, providing round-the-clock support and even sustainably retire devices at the end of their usefulness.

One advantage of managed device service solutions is that your devices are always supported by a team of experts that keep them updated and secure. Team members that split their work between IT and non-IT duties can focus on other core responsibilities, which can result in increased productivity as well as potential cost savings in staffing and outsourcing fees.

Access to 24/7 support can also help increase business productivity and decrease downtime. Support teams can assist with everything from setting up new devices to troubleshooting common problems. Many organizations operate outside of conventional business hours or have staff in different time zones, making it all the more challenging to manage. By leveraging a managed device service solution, you can ensure team members have access to the help they need while reducing overall IT disruption.

Security is also top of mind for most organizations and for resource-constrained businesses, managing, securing and updating devices can be difficult. Yet another benefit is an improved security posture. Managed device service solutions can offer features like 24/7 monitoring, hardware-level security and systemized updates that are out of reach for many smaller organizations. And for organizations in regulated industries or with compliance mandates, this level of support can be particularly helpful.
